Some of the ways in which individuals and companies can participate in OpenZFS.

If you make a product with OpenZFS

Have your logo on the companies page:

  • contact admin at open-zfs.org for help

When you talk publicly about ZFS, use the term OpenZFS and link to this website.

If you are an OpenZFS admin / user

Spread the word:

  • blog
  • tweet (#OpenZFS)
  • write for magazines, and so on.

Help to organize this site, or write documentation.

If you write code

Join the developer mailing list:

  • stay informed about OpenZFS work in your area.
  • get design help or feedback on your code changes.

Contribute your code changes upstream.

Learn from OpenZFS developer resources.

Make others aware of your projects on the mailing list and projects page.

Join the monthly Leadership Team Meeting.
